密碼登錄命令行:ssh用戶名@主機名-p端口。
用戶名:登錄用戶名。
主機名:ssh服務器,可以是ip或域名。
端口:這是可選的,即ssh服務器的端口。如果為空,默認端口為22。
密鑰登錄使用加密
在終端下生成密鑰命令:ssh-keygen -t rsa(如果不輸入密碼,則不需要密碼)。
在生成過程中,系統會提示您輸入密鑰文件的名稱。如果輸入Key,將生成兩個文件:Key和Key.pub。Key是私鑰,Key.pub是公鑰。把鑰匙放在。ssh目錄的本地用戶目錄,並更改。ssh目錄到700。
將生成的public Key.pub上傳到目標服務器,並將其放在。用戶目錄的ssh目錄和。ssh目錄也是700。
然後執行cat key . pub》》;Authorized_keys導入公鑰並確定authorized_keys權限為600。
配置好密鑰後,您可以執行ssh-I key username @ hostname-p port。
ssh的默認密鑰是id_rsa,需要添加參數-i來表示密鑰。